How to Enable/Disable Breadcrumbs in Magento 2

Sometimes, your customers can end up getting lost in your store, especially if they've navigated through a few pages. Breadcrumbs can serve as a navigational aid to let them know exactly where they currently are, and allow them to return to a previous page at the click of a button. Enabling Breadcrumbs on your Magento 2 instance is quite easy, and can be done directly via the Admin Options. Here's how you can do that:


Head into your Magento Admin panel and navigate into:


Stores -> Settings -> Configuration -> Web -> Default Pages -> Show Breadcrumbs for CMS Pages


Set the option to Yes, and Save the Config.

Afterward, flush the Magento Cache from the Cache Management section, and your Breadcrumbs should be displayed on CMS pages.
